Looking for a Streamlight TLR-2 Green Laser?

Posted on January 15, 2013 by Brian

Streamlight had a pretty impressive display at SHOT Show this year, including the Green Laser Version of their Mega-Popular TLR-2!  No doubt it’ll be a big hit! Streamlight debuted a variety of new handheld lights, and two features were dominant: high-lumen and green.

Streamlight Strion at SHOT Show

For a quality handheld option, the Streamlight Strion series is a great option, and there are new high lumen models coming!

First, we took a look at the Strion series – new high-lumen LED models will be coming out soon.

The New TLR-2 HL From SHOT Show

The TLR-2 HL is a more powerful version of one of Streamlight’s Most Popular weapon lights!

Two of the most popular weapon lights of all time have been the TLR-1 and TLR-2, and after the wild success of the TLR-4 in 2012, Streamlight put some focus into offering new models of these classics boasting great new features. Both the TLR-1 and TLR-2 are set to come in new high lumen versions – the TLR-2 high lumen model will continue to offer a red laser as well.

The New TLR-2 Green Laser Sight From SHOT Show

Who could resist a TLR-2 with a Green Laser? Not Us!

The big news was the introduction of a TLR-2 with a green laser. People have been clamoring for this for years, and it’ll finally arrive this year. We expect this to be extremely popular.

The New TLR-1 Game Spotter Sight at SHOT Show 2013

The TLR-1 Game Spotter helps you find game with a true green LED light!

For hunters, Streamlight is also releasing the TLR-1 Game Spotter this year – with a true green LED perfect for spotting wounded game. This is not a filtered white light – it’s true green and designed specifically for the hunting community.

    If the TLR-2 is the best weapons rail sight since sliced bread, Why did they skip a 3 and went to a TLR-4 and just exactly what is that model? Better than, equal to, or less of an item than the publicized TLR-2?

    • Alessandro
      January 16, 2013

      Hey Kevin! They didn’t skip the TLR-3. The TLR-3 was a lower-powered smaller version of the TLR-1, designed to fit more compact pistols. There’s a little more to it – it’s not just a carbon copy of the TLR-1.

      The TLR-4 follows the same pattern with the TLR-2, it’s a compact laser/light combo. If you have a full-size firearm, I suggest the TLR-2. If you have a compact (or even medium size), go with the TLR-4.
